Technical Context
The MDA3KP12A is a single-channel, unidirectional TVS diode optimized for fast clamping of high-energy transients. Its <100 ps response time enables effective suppression of ESD (IEC61000-4-2), EFT (IEC61000-4-4), and induced switching surges before downstream circuitry is damaged.
It delivers 3000 W peak pulse power at 10/1000 µs waveform with 19.9 V clamping voltage at 150.6 A IPP, and maintains stable operation across −55 °C to +150 °C junction temperature. Standby leakage is ≤5 µA at 12 V VWM, supporting low-power system monitoring integrity.

FAQ
What is the clamping voltage of MDA3KP12A at its rated peak pulse current?
The MDA3KP12A has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 19.9 V at its rated peak pulse current (IPP) of 150.6 A under 10/1000 µs waveform conditions. This value is measured per standard test methods and guarantees the protected circuit will not experience more than 19.9 V during full-rated surge events - critical for safeguarding 12 V rail-sensitive components. The MDA3KP12A datasheet specifies this as an absolute maximum limit across temperature and production lots.
Is MDA3KP12A RoHS compliant?
Yes, MDA3KP12A is RoHS compliant, indicated by the "e3" suffix in its full manufacturer marking per Microsemi's nomenclature guide. The device uses annealed matte-tin plating on terminations and void-free UL94V-0 epoxy packaging, meeting lead-free soldering requirements up to 260 °C for 10 seconds. This compliance is verified in the official RF01243 Rev B datasheet and applies to all units shipped post-RoHS transition.
Does MDA3KP12A support bidirectional operation?
No, MDA3KP12A is a unidirectional TVS device. Its part number lacks the "C" suffix (e.g., MDA3KP12CA), which Microsemi reserves exclusively for bidirectional variants. The MDA3KP12A conducts only during reverse-biased overvoltage events - forward conduction is limited to 4.0 V at 500 A, confirming its intended use as a cathode-to-line protector. For AC or dual-polarity protection, MDA3KP12CA must be selected instead.
What is the maximum operating temperature for MDA3KP12A?
The MDA3KP12A has a specified junction and storage temperature range of −55 °C to +150 °C. This wide range is validated per Microsemi's qualification testing and enables use in under-hood automotive modules, industrial inverters, and outdoor telecom enclosures. Derating of peak pulse power begins above 25 °C per Figure 3 in the RF01243 datasheet, with 50% power capability retained at +125 °C ambient.
How does MDA3KP12A compare to standard SMA/SMB/SMC package TVS diodes in surge rating?
Unlike standard SMA (400 W), SMB (600 W), or SMC (1500 W) TVS diodes, the MDA3KP12A delivers 3000 W peak pulse power in the same SMC (DO-214AB) package - achieved through proprietary die construction and enhanced thermal design. This allows drop-in replacement in existing SMC footprints while raising surge immunity to IEC61000-4-5 Class 4 levels. The MDA3KP12A maintains identical mounting and reflow profiles but doubles the energy handling of typical SMCJ-class devices.
